原文:EF的左连接查询

在EF中,当在dbset使用join关联多表查询时,连接查询的表如果没有建立相应的外键关系时,EF生成的SQL语句是inner join 内联 ,对于inner join,有所了解的同学都知道,很多时候这并不是我们的本意,实例如下: EF生成了内连接 inner join 查询,当两个表的任一表的数据不匹配时,查询结果就为空 实际上left join 左联接 才是我们想要的,那么怎么样才能生成le ...

2017-04-04 19:22 0 2614 推荐指数:

查看详情

EF Linq中的连接Left Join查询

}的时候怎么办呢,这就是连接,反之,如果是{null,3} 则是右连接。 这样即是连 ...

Thu May 10 17:43:00 CST 2018 0 3293
Linq to EF连接连接

Linq中连接主要有组连接、内连接连接、交叉连接四种。本文主要讲解没连接连接。 本次使用到的数据实体模型具体的创建方法不再累述。该实体模型中包括Student、Course两个表,他们之间是一对多的关系。 一、内连接连接与SqL中inner join一样,即找出 ...

Wed Aug 19 22:15:00 CST 2015 0 9483
ef实现关联查询

EF中,当在dbset使用join关联多表查询时,连接查询的表如果没有建立相应的外键关系时,EF生成的SQL语句是inner join(内联),对于inner join,有所了解的同学都知道,很多时候这并不是我们的本意,实例如下: EF生成了内连接(inner join)查询,当两个表 ...

Mon May 13 06:30:00 CST 2019 0 497
EF的表连接方法Include和Join

EF中表连接常用的有Join()和Include(),两者都可以实现两张表的连接,但又有所不同。 例如有个唱片表Album(AlbumId,Name,CreateDate,GenreId),表中含外键GenreId连接流派表Genre(GenreId,Name)。每个唱片归属唯一一个流派,一个 ...

Sun Nov 15 00:35:00 CST 2015 0 8109
SQL查询语句连接

别名 可以将某一字段名显示(修改)成其他名称 查询所有 SELECT g.id,g.name,g.specs,g.barcode,g.company,g.url,c.name AS classify FROM product g LEFT JOIN classify c ...

Thu May 21 06:13:00 CST 2020 0 7585
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M